The work is divided mainly in two parts-(i) the principal work, i.e., the 30 lectures, and (ii) the three Appendices. Besides, there is a detailed chapter entitled 'Introduction'.
It is essential that before starting the study of this work, one should carefully read the introduction which gives (i) in some detail the importance and significance of the study of Sanskrit, (ii) a critical note on Pâriini's and other Sanskrit grammars written in European or Indian languages, and (iii) the details of the plan of the proposed method which makes a neo-scientific approach to the study of Sanskrit with emphasis on the study of participles.
First six lectures :
As for the principal work of the thirty lectures, the first six lectures give general information regarding Sanskrit and its grammar, dealing with (i) Sanskrit in the classification of languages, (ii) Sanskrit alphabet, (iii) Nature of euphonic changes, (iv) Structure of Sanskrit and general classification of its words, (v) Voices and Participles, and (vi) Conjugation.
